Sodium Bisulfate
Sodium bisulfate (chemical formular:NaHSO4),also known as sodium acid sulfate. White granular crystal, melting point 58.50,heat loss of crystallization water into anhydride, reheat is decomposed into coke sodium bisulfate, soluble in water and acid reaction.

Application
1. Sodium Bisulphate CAS No.7681-38-1 as PH modifying agent to replace vitriol, and used as detergent for ceramic, marble and toilet.
2. Sodium Bisulphate is used in bleaching agent, leather, dyeing auxiliary, solvent, disinfectant and detergent for in daily chemical industry.
3. Sodium bisulphate is used to treat water for example:PH reduction in Swimming pools and Spas.
4. Sodium bisulphate also can used in metal industry,dyeing plants and leather textile.
5. Sodium Bisulphate as ph modifying agent to replace vitriol, detergent for ceramic, marble and toilet, used as pretreatment agent for acid washing and plating coating.
